Subject: [PATCH v2] perf test perftool_testsuite: Add missing shellcheck
 source directive

Add shellcheck source directive to prevent old versions of shellcheck to
issue warning SC1090 for perf shell scripts, e.g.:

    In tests/shell/base_probe/test_line_semantics.sh line 20:
    . "$DIR_PATH/../common/init.sh"
      ^---------------------------^ SC1090: Can't follow non-constant source. Use a directive to specify location.

shellcheck versions since 0.7.2 handle such dynamic source includes in a
more friendly manner [1]; older versions show the warning and thus
break the perf build unless NO_SHELLCHECK is set to '1'.

Another way w/o new shellcheck directives would be to update the minimum
shellcheck version in tools/perf/Makefile.perf to 0.7.2.  I'll send
that as an alternative patch.

Newer versions of shellcheck are available since e.g.
Debian bookworm 12 (released: 2023/06), Ubuntu jammy 22.04 (released:
2022/04), Fedora 37 (released: 2022/11)
